Fact check: Has the shooter in custody made any public statements about their motives?
1. Summary of the results
The analyses provided suggest that the shooter, Tyler Robinson, has not made any public statements about his motives for the shooting [1] [2] [3]. However, some sources mention that Robinson had expressed his dislike for Charlie Kirk and had written a note indicating an opportunity to take him out [2] [4]. It is also reported that Robinson is not cooperating with authorities and has not confessed to the crime [1] [2] [3]. Additionally, sources state that Robinson's family members and friends are cooperating with investigators, but he himself has not provided any direct quotes or statements regarding his motives [5] [6].
